首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将处理程序的对象传递给v-on和访问方法

将处理程序的对象传递给v-on是Vue.js中的一种事件绑定方式。v-on是Vue.js的指令之一,用于监听DOM事件并触发相应的处理函数。

在Vue.js中,可以使用v-on指令将事件处理程序绑定到DOM元素上。当指定的事件触发时,Vue.js会自动调用相应的处理函数。处理函数可以是Vue实例中定义的方法,也可以是内联函数。

要将处理程序的对象传递给v-on,可以使用对象语法。对象语法允许我们在触发事件时传递额外的参数或数据给处理函数。具体做法是在v-on指令后面使用对象字面量的形式,将事件名作为键,处理函数作为值。

示例代码如下:

代码语言:txt
复制
<button v-on="{ click: handleClick }">Click me</button>

在上述代码中,我们将一个对象传递给v-on指令,对象的键为"click",值为handleClick方法。这样,当按钮被点击时,Vue.js会调用handleClick方法。

除了对象语法,还可以使用内联语句或方法名的形式将处理程序传递给v-on。具体使用哪种形式取决于实际需求和个人偏好。

总结一下,将处理程序的对象传递给v-on是Vue.js中一种事件绑定方式,可以使用对象语法将事件名和处理函数作为键值对传递给v-on指令。这样可以实现在触发事件时调用相应的处理函数,并且可以传递额外的参数或数据给处理函数。

推荐的腾讯云相关产品:腾讯云函数(Serverless Cloud Function),腾讯云云开发(Tencent Cloud Base),腾讯云物联网开发平台(Tencent IoT Explorer)。

腾讯云函数(Serverless Cloud Function):腾讯云函数是一种无服务器计算服务,可以让您无需管理服务器即可运行代码。它支持多种编程语言,可以根据事件触发自动运行代码,适用于各种场景,如网站后端、数据处理、定时任务等。了解更多请访问:腾讯云函数产品介绍

腾讯云云开发(Tencent Cloud Base):腾讯云云开发是一款全托管的后端云服务,提供了前后端一体化的开发能力。它支持快速开发小程序、网站和移动应用,提供了数据库、存储、云函数等功能,让开发者可以专注于业务逻辑的实现。了解更多请访问:腾讯云云开发产品介绍

腾讯云物联网开发平台(Tencent IoT Explorer):腾讯云物联网开发平台是一款全面托管的物联网云服务,提供了设备接入、数据存储、规则引擎、可视化开发等功能。它可以帮助开发者快速构建物联网应用,实现设备与云端的连接和通信。了解更多请访问:腾讯云物联网开发平台产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

WMI Series :管理对象信息查询方法访问

管理对象信息查询方法访问 在这一节内容,我们通过几个实例来学习如何查询管理对象信息访问管理对象提供方法,这一部分内容将使用到我们在前面讲述到 System.Management 命名空间中相关类对象...( 2 ) Size 属性数据是以 bytes 字节为单位。 上面访问方法其实很简单,我们再看看如何通过 SQL 查询方式来访问管理对象数据。...管理对象方法访问 在 Windows2000 任务管理器中,我们可以终止进程,也可以启动进程;在服务管理器中,我们可以启动、暂停、 7 终止服务,那么您肯定会问通过程序怎样完成类似上面的任务...是的,对于那些可供用户操作管理对象,它提供可一些公开方法供客户端应用程序来调用,从而完成各种任务。上面的例子只是给出了单向信息访问,接下来内容,我们看看如何访问管理对象方法。...并不是所有的管理对象会公开方法,是否公开方法公开那些方法取决于需要。

53210

英伟达AMD研发基于Arm架构PC处理

10月24日消息,据路透社报道报道,已经占据了约 80% PC独立显卡市场以及大部分 AI HPC GPU 市场英伟达(NVIDIA),似乎已准备好进军支持运行微软Windows系统PC处理器市场...,此外AMD也进入这一市场。...而AMD英伟达决定提供研发基于 Arm架构PC CPU将是一项战略举措,将与微软更广泛合作,以增强基于 Arm处理Windows PC ,旨在更有效地与搭载苹果基于 Arm架构自研SoC...但一旦该专有权到期,一些大型新玩家进入该市场。 微软参与至关重要,因为它旨在鼓励促进 PC 行业内基于 Arm 处理开发采用。...AMD英伟达需要与苹果高通等老牌厂商竞争,后者分别自 2016 年 2020 年以来一直在生产基于 Arm架构笔记本电脑芯片。 与此同时,这一努力成功还需要克服重大技术障碍。

30020
  • Vue父子组件通信

    Prop 是你可以在组件上注册一些自定义 attribute。 当一个值传递给一个 prop attribute 时候,它就变成了那个组件实例一个 property。...在上述模板中,你会发现我们能够在组件实例中访问这个值,就像访问data中值一样。...这时,我们可以以对象形式列出 prop,这些 property 名称值分别是 prop 各自名称类型: props: { title: String, likes: Number,...3.1.在props中我们可以一个值做一个对象元素传入,对其做三个限定.如下如代码中name type 约定该元素类型 default 约定默认值(如果父组件不传入值的话直接使用默认值) required...} } 二 子父---通过监听子组件事件传递数据信号给父组件 不同于组件 prop,事件名不存在任何自动化大小写转换。

    1.2K10

    一个合格中级前端工程师应该掌握 20 个 Vue 技巧

    作用域插槽大致思路是 DOM 结构交给调用方去决定,组件内部只关注业务逻辑,最后数据事件等通过 :item ="item" 方式传递给父组件去处理调用,实现 UI 业务逻辑分离。...:可以动态指令参数传递给组件。...可以通过声明 functional: true,表明它是一个函数式组件 在作为包装组件时候,它们是非常有用 程序化地在多个组件中选择一个来代为渲染 在 children、props、data 传递给子组件之前操作它们...Vue 内部会用它来处理 data 函数返回对象。返回对象可以直接用于渲染函数计算属性内,并且会在发生变更时触发相应更新。...很多时候,我们想要在内联处理器中访问原始 DOM 事件(而且同时想其他参数),可以使用 $event 把它传入。 <!

    6K20

    只会Vue怎么开发小程序?Vue微信小程序到底有哪些区别?

    控制元素显示隐藏 小程序中,使用wx-ifhidden控制元素显示隐藏 五、事件处理 vue:使用v-on:event绑定事件,或者使用@event绑定事件,例如: <button v-on...当表单内容发生变化时,会触发表单元素上绑定方法,然后在该方法中,通过this.setData({key:value})来表单上值赋值给data中对应值。...七、绑定事件参 在vue中,绑定事件参挺简单,只需要在触发事件方法中,把需要传递数据作为形参传入就可以了,例如: </button...$emit方法和数据传递给父组件。...在小程序中 父组件向子组件通信vue类似,但是小程序没有通过v-bind,而是直接值赋值给一个变量,如下: 此处,

    1.7K10

    VUE——vue中组件之间通信方式有哪些

    时候,也可以这个 .sync 修饰符 v-bind 配合使用: 这样会把 doc 对象每一个属性...(如 title) 都作为一个独立 prop 进去,然后各自添加用于更新 `v-on 监听器。...子组件向父组件值 2.1 通过事件值$emit 使用: 子组件使用$emit发送一个自定义事件 父组件使用指令v-on监听子组件发送事件 <child-component...3.1 Bus中央事件总线 非父子组件值,可以使用一个空Vue实力作为中央事件总线,结合实例方法on,emit使用 注意: 注册Bus要在组件销毁时卸载,否则会多次挂载,造成触发一次但多个响应情况...⚠️ 注意:官网文档提及 provide inject 主要为高阶插件/组件库提供用例,并不推荐直接用于应用程序代码中。

    10710

    Vue 2.X 文档阅读笔记一 (基础)

    其中如选择参数写成内联调用事件回调方法,可以对所调用回调进行参,当方法逻辑中需要访问原始DOM事件时,可以特殊变量$event作为参数传入回调方法,该变量作用是可以访问原生js事件对象event...b.事件修饰符 通常事件处理程序中会调用event.preventDefault()取消默认事件event.stopPropagation()阻止冒泡与捕获事件。...一个组件可以拥有任意数量prop特性,任何值都可以传递给任何prop特性,在组件实例中访问prop特性就像访问data中值一样。...d.监听组件中事件 当父子组件之间要进行沟通时,可以在父组件内通过v-on监听某个事件名,并定义该事件名对应事件处理函数,同时在子组件内通过调用内建$emit方法并传入该事件名来触发它。...,并定义事件触发处理函数listenFn;子组件通过v-on绑定事件触发条件click,当条件满足(发生click事件)时通过内建方法$emit()触发被父组件监听事件名,从而执行父组件中该事件监听器定义事件处理函数

    3.5K70

    Vue学习笔记---暂保存

    有缓存管理机制,可减少页面调用次数 无缓存机制,调用次数,取决于页面中有所多少过滤器 计算属性虽默认为只读,但可以定义为对象,开启可读可写模式 只能读取操作 计算属性被作为一个类属性调用 过滤器被作为一个特殊方法处理...,事件名也应该使用短横线分割方法命名,如果事件用v-on:myEvent 命名,就会变成v-on:myevent....3.1.在props中我们可以一个值做一个对象元素传入,对其做三个限定.如下如代码中name type 约定该元素类型 default 约定默认值(如果父组件不传入值的话直接使用默认值) required...Vue父子组件访问方式 如果我们不需要利用父子组件通信去交换什么数据或者信号,我们仅仅需要父组件直接访问子组件,子组件直接访问父组件,或者是子组件访问根组件,从而可以相互得到对方组件里数据方法,那么不必用之前...prop自定义事件. 2.1 .Vue提供了一些方法可以达到父子互相访问效果.

    3K20

    Week 1: Vue.JS

    ,最好也提供key属性以便跟踪每个节点(在组件中必须提供),对于子元素只能是特定元素情况,可以使用is属性 计算属性侦听器 计算属性 Vue实例中computed对象函数: computed:...有需要的话,计算属性对象可以分成getset。 侦听器 当variable变化,控制台输出新值旧值。...v-on指令内容可以是方法或一个js表达式,调用方法时可以传入$event 监听键盘事件,KeyboardEvent.key 支持按键名转换为...Vue组件 组件简介 组件是可复用Vue实例,除了组件特性,与Vue根实例不同是,组件data必须是一个函数,这个函数返回值才是data内容,由于js对于对象引用值,函数确保了每个组件都维护一份自己数据..."> 传递事件 子组件事件传递给父组件() 父组件<elf v-on:event-x="..."

    1.4K30

    Vue值与状态管理总结

    取而代之是,你只能提供你想要绑定属性名 v-bind.sync用在一个字面量对象上,例如v-bind.sync=”{ title: doc.title }”,是无法正常工作,因为在解析一个像这样复杂表达式时候...通过v-bind=" 当我们对第三方组件进行封装时,我们可以通过attrslisteners直接将我们不需要处理属性事件直接传递给引用组件,例如对ElementUIInput组件进行封装使其只能输入数字...input事件,v-on通过对象绑定事件可以单独绑定同名事件共存,并且两者都生效 events () { let ret = {} Object.keys(this....不含.native修饰器v-on事件监听器 v-on通过对象绑定事件可以单独绑定同名事件共存,并且两者都生效 跨越层级 - provide/inject provide/inject是一对需要配套使用属性...使用常规prop事件结合方式,在这样场景下过于繁琐了,而使用实例方式,我们代码可能会更加简洁: <!

    2.2K20

    程序员过关斩--来自于静态方法实例方法联想翩翩

    面向对象概念应用已超越了程序设计软件开发,扩展到如数据库系统、交互式界面、应用结构、应用平台、分布式系统、网络管理结构、CAD技术、人工智能等领域。...面向对象是一种对现实世界理解抽象方法,是计算机编程技术发展到一定阶段后产物。 ? 谈到面向对象思想,首先你得有一个对象才可以。...说白话一点,到底是使用实例方法还是静态方法取决于业务场景,当你业务中每个对象都有自己状态,或者行为,这些状态行为是只属于当前对象,那你行为可以设计成实例方法。...实际项目中会发现有很多helper类里边都是静态方法,因为这些方法具体对象具体对象行为状态没有任何关系。因为具体实例没有连接,所以这类型静态方法几乎都是线程安全。...实例化太多对象在java/c#这类带有GC编程语言中会引发垃圾回收操作,当垃圾回收进行时候会挂起所有的线程,所以在这个短暂时间里,程序会卡顿。 静态方法常驻内存? ?

    48020

    程序员过关斩--来自于静态方法实例方法联想翩翩

    面向对象概念应用已超越了程序设计软件开发,扩展到如数据库系统、交互式界面、应用结构、应用平台、分布式系统、网络管理结构、CAD技术、人工智能等领域。...面向对象是一种对现实世界理解抽象方法,是计算机编程技术发展到一定阶段后产物。 谈到面向对象思想,首先你得有一个对象才可以。...说白话一点,到底是使用实例方法还是静态方法取决于业务场景,当你业务中每个对象都有自己状态,或者行为,这些状态行为是只属于当前对象,那你行为可以设计成实例方法。...实际项目中会发现有很多helper类里边都是静态方法,因为这些方法具体对象具体对象行为状态没有任何关系。因为具体实例没有连接,所以这类型静态方法几乎都是线程安全。...分布式高并发下Actor模型如此优秀●程序员过关斩--论商品促销代码优雅性 ●程序员过关斩--请不要随便修改基类 ●程序员过关斩--你面向接口编程一定对吗?

    47920

    vue$attrs_vue获取list集合中对象

    使用场景 $attrs:用于父组件隔代向孙组件值。 $listeners:用于孙组件隔代向父组件值。 当然,这两个也可以同时使用,达到父组件孙组件双向目的。...attrs:包含了父作用域中没有被 prop 接收所有属性(不包含class style 属性)。可以通过 v-bind=”attrs” 直接这些属性传入内部组件。...使用B来做中转,A传递给B,B再给C**,**这是最容易想到方案,但是如果嵌套组件过多,需要传递事件属性较多,会导致代码繁琐,代码维护困难。...访问:http://localhost:8080/#/parent 一开始,父组件孙组件数据不一致,都是初始数据。...解决方案:在el-table使用地方加上v-on=”listeners”v-bind=”attrs”,这样使用page-table地方可使用所有el-table属性事件。

    5.2K10

    python-异常处理错误调试-异步IO程序调试方法(三)

    使用 asyncio debug 工具进行调试Python 中 asyncio 模块提供了一些有用 debug 工具,可以帮助我们更好地理解异步IO程序运行状态,并找到程序错误。...在本节中,我们介绍 asyncio debug 工具,并介绍如何使用这些工具进行调试。...在使用 asyncio debug 工具进行调试时,我们需要注意以下几点:我们需要在程序中启用 asyncio debug 模式,从而使程序输出更详细信息。...对于每个任务,我们使用 task.print_stack() 函数输出任务调用栈。当程序出现错误时,我们可以使用该方法查看任务调用栈,从而更好地理解程序运行状态。...除了 asyncio.Task.all_tasks() asyncio.Task.print_stack() 函数之外,Python 中 asyncio 模块还提供了许多有用 debug 工具,

    1.4K81

    Google Earth Engine(GEE)——重温对象方法介绍如何计算程序运行时间?

    构造函数接受其参数(可能还有其他参数),将其放入容器中,然后容器及其内容作为可以在代码中操作 Earth Engine 对象返回。...任何以 开头构造函数都会ee 返回一个 Earth Engine 对象。 Earth Engine 对象方法 请注意,一旦创建了地球引擎对象,就必须使用地球引擎方法处理它。...列表 要将 JavaScript 列表变成ee.List服务器上对象,您可以像数字字符串一样 JavaScript 文字放入容器中。...作为程序员,您知道value前面示例中变量是一个数字对象。...虽然它可能是更多代码,但它可以提高可读性可重用性。要按名称传递参数,请传入一个 JavaScript 对象,其中对象键是方法参数名称,值是方法参数。

    16410

    python-异常处理错误调试-异步IO程序调试方法(二)

    使用日志系统进行调试日志系统是一种常用调试工具,可以帮助我们记录程序运行状态,找到程序错误,并进行调试。在异步IO程序中,我们也可以使用日志系统进行调试。...在使用日志系统进行异步IO程序调试时,我们需要注意以下几点:在程序中,我们需要使用日志系统输出关键信息,以便在出现错误时更好地理解程序运行状态。...例如,我们可以代码修改为如下所示:import asyncioimport loggingasync def coro(): logging.info("Start coro") await...在事件循环 run_until_complete() 方法中,我们使用 logging.basicConfig() 函数设置日志级别为 DEBUG,从而记录所有级别的日志信息。...当程序运行时,我们可以在控制台中看到输出日志信息,从而更好地理解程序运行状态。

    682171

    python-异常处理错误调试-异步IO程序调试方法(一)

    异步IO程序是一种高效编程方式,但是由于其特殊运行方式,调试起来也有其特殊难点。使用调试器进行调试调试器是一种常用调试工具,可以帮助我们更好地理解程序运行状态,找到程序错误,并进行调试。...在本文中,我们将以 pdb 为例介绍异步IO程序调试方法。在使用 pdb 进行异步IO程序调试时,我们需要在程序中设置断点。...由于异步IO程序通常运行在事件循环中,因此我们需要在事件循环 run_until_complete() 方法中设置断点。...例如,我们可以代码修改为如下所示:import asyncioasync def coro(): await asyncio.sleep(1) a = 1 / 0 await asyncio.sleep...在事件循环 run_until_complete() 方法中,我们使用 pdb.set_trace() 函数设置了一个断点,从而使程序在此处暂停执行。

    1K81
    领券